PA23/05708: A proposed rear extension with internal alterations for a property in Bude has been approved by Cornwall Council.
Mr and Mrs Adey applied to the local authority to undertake the works at their property at 11 Killerton Road, Bude.
Bude-Stratton Town Council said in response to the consultation: “BSTC had no objection to the extension but would prefer to see a pitched roof treatment and rain water harvesting.”
It was approved subject to the following conditions: “The development hereby permitted shall be begun before the expiration of 3 years from the date of this permission. Reason: In accordance with the requirements of Section 91 of the Town and Country Planning Act 1990 (as amended by Section 51 of the Planning and Compulsory Purchase Act 2004).
“The development hereby permitted shall be carried out in accordance with the plans listed below under the heading "Plans Referred to in Consideration of this Application". Reason: For the avoidance of doubt and in the interests of proper planning.”
